Choosing the Right Smartwatch for Seniors
When selecting a smartwatch, certain factors should be considered:
Ease of Use
Seniors may not be tech-savvy, so it’s essential to choose a watch that is user-friendly, with a simple interface and easy navigation.
Comfort and Design
The smartwatch should be comfortable to wear all day. Opt for designs that are lightweight and have adjustable straps.
Battery Life
A long battery life ensures that the watch remains functional throughout the day without frequent charging.
Compatibility
Ensure the smartwatch is compatible with the smartphone being used. Some watches also work independently without the need for a phone.

FAQs About Heart Rate Monitor Smartwatches for Elderly
Are these smartwatches safe for seniors?
Yes, they are designed with safety in mind, offering features like fall detection and emergency SOS.
Do seniors need a smartphone to use these watches?
Some smartwatches can function independently, but having a smartphone enhances their features.
How accurate is the heart rate monitoring?
Most modern smartwatches offer highly accurate heart rate monitoring, but it’s always good to cross-check with medical devices.
